一、填空题
1. $25×(-1.58)÷\sqrt[3]{\dfrac{1}{64}}=$
2. $(-84)÷(-7+\sqrt{16})-(-3)^2=$
3. $(-5)-(-5)×\sqrt[3]{\dfrac{1}{125}}=$
4. $3.35+\sqrt[3]{-0.216}-1.35=$
5. 一题多解 $-99\dfrac{8}{9}×\sqrt{81}=$
6. $36.9×(-\dfrac{1}{5})-73.1÷\sqrt[3]{125}=$
7. $\sqrt[3]{-\dfrac{1}{27}}+|2-\sqrt{3}|+\sqrt{(-\dfrac{1}{3})^2}=$
8. $\sqrt{4}+(π-3.14)^0-(\dfrac{1}{3})^{-1}+\sqrt[3]{27}=$

答案
1. -158
2. 19
3. -4
4. 1.4
5. -899
解析:解法一 $-99\dfrac{8}{9}×\sqrt{81}=-99\dfrac{8}{9}×9=-\dfrac{899}{9}×9=-899.$
解法二 $-99\dfrac{8}{9}×\sqrt{81}=-99\dfrac{8}{9}×9=-(100-\dfrac{1}{9})×9=-(100×9-\dfrac{1}{9}×9)=-(900-1)=-899.$
6. -22
7. $2-\sqrt{3}$
8. 3

二、计算题
9. $(-\sqrt{36}) ×(-3)+2 ×(-4)$
10. $\sqrt[3]{-512} ÷ \dfrac{1}{2} × 2-4$
11. $|-2| ×[\sqrt[3]{8}-(-3)]-\sqrt{289}$
12. $-9-[5-(-44) ÷ \sqrt{4}] ÷ \sqrt[3]{729}$
13. $[(-7)-\sqrt[3]{-8}] × \sqrt{9}+(-\dfrac{1}{6}) ÷(-\dfrac{1}{12})$
14. $(\dfrac{1}{2}-\sqrt[3]{\dfrac{1}{27}}) ÷(-\sqrt{\dfrac{1}{36}})+(-2)^3 ×(-6)$
15. $[(-5) ×(-\dfrac{5}{8})-19 ×(-\sqrt{\dfrac{25}{64}})] ÷ \sqrt[3]{-27}$
16. $(-\dfrac{1}{2}-\sqrt[3]{64}+\sqrt{\dfrac{49}{144}}-\dfrac{5}{6}) ÷(-\dfrac{1}{12})+\sqrt[3]{-5}+|-\sqrt[3]{5}|$

答案
9. 10
10. -36
11. -7
12. -12
13. -13
14. 47
15. -5
16. 57
